A vulnerability classified as critical has been found in Linux Kernel up to 5.15.60/5.18.17/5.19.1. This affects the function in_atomic of the component riscv. The manipulation with an unknown input leads to a memory corruption vulnerability. CWE is classifying the issue as CWE-119. The product performs operations on a memory buffer, but it can read from or write to a memory location that is outside of the intended boundary of the buffer. This is going to have an impact on confidentiality, integrity, and availability. The summary by CVE is:

In the Linux kernel, the following vulnerability has been resolved: riscv:uprobe fix SR_SPIE set/clear handling In riscv the process of uprobe going to clear spie before exec the origin insn,and set spie after that.But When access the page which origin insn has been placed a page fault may happen and irq was disabled in arch_uprobe_pre_xol function,It cause a WARN as follows. There is no need to clear/set spie in arch_uprobe_pre/post/abort_xol. We can just remove it. It is possible to read the advisory at git.kernel.org. This vulnerability is uniquely identified as CVE-2022-50225 since 06/18/2025. The exploitability is told to be easy. Technical details of the vulnerability are known, but there is no available exploit. The pricing for an exploit might be around USD $0-$5k at the moment (estimation calculated on 01/14/2026).

Upgrading to version 5.15.61, 5.18.18 or 5.19.2 eliminates this vulnerability. Applying the patch c71e000db8536d27ec410abb3e314896a78b4f19/3811d51778900064d27d8c9a98f73410fb3b471d/73fc099eaefd9a92c83b6c07dad066411fd5a192/3dbe5829408bc1586f75b4667ef60e5aab0209c7 is able to eliminate this problem. The bugfix is ready for download at git.kernel.org. The best possible mitigation is suggested to be upgrading to the latest version.
